    No wave was an avant-garde music genre and visual art scene which emerged in the late 1970s in Downtown New York City. [4] [5] The term was a pun based on the rejection of commercial new wave music. [6] Reacting against punk rock 's recycling of rock and roll clichés, no wave musicians instead experimented with noise, dissonance, and atonality ...

  8. No Wave remains one of the most obscure, short-lived, mysterious and influential musical movements of the 20th century. No Wave began in 1976-1977 during the same time period as early punk rock and New Wave. It was characterized by a harsh, rhythm based sound, nihilistic lyrics and shouted or monotone vocals mixed with noisy, atonal guitar and ...
